Fire alarm

In the event of a fire, water from sprinklers or suppression systems often mixes with stock materials and rainwater, creating a highly polluted runoff. Rapidly isolating drainage is critical to preventing contaminated water from reaching the environment.
The ToggleBlok System can be easily linked to your fire alarm. By connecting the fire panel’s volt-free, normally open signal to the ToggleBlok controller, the valve will automatically close five seconds after the alarm is triggered. Delivering fast, reliable protection.
pH

pH measures the acidity or alkalinity of water, with 7 being neutral.
Many sites monitor pH as part of discharge consent compliance, ensuring water leaving the premises remains within permitted limits.
Most pH monitoring systems are equipped with analogue relays, which can be configured to trigger the ToggleBlok Valve if a pre-set pH threshold is breached for more than five seconds, helping to contain potentially harmful discharges before they enter the drainage system.
Turbidity

Turbidity sensors detect suspended solids in water and are commonly used on construction sites or at food processing facilities like dairies. Substances such as clay or milk can trigger high turbidity alarms, indicating contamination.
These monitors typically include analogue relays and can be configured to activate the ToggleBlok Valve automatically if turbidity exceeds the set limit for more than five seconds. Dual-function controllers are also available, allowing pH and turbidity to be managed together with shared hardware.
Oil Separator Alarm

Since 2005, UK regulations have required oil separators to include alarms that detect hydrocarbon build-up. These alarms ensure the separator is functioning properly and can alert you before oil breaches the system and enters the drainage network.
ToggleBlok can be directly linked to oil separator alarms, enabling the valve to close when high oil levels are detected or in the event of a spillage. Preventing harmful discharge and enabling rapid containment.
Flood monitoring

Flood level sensors range from basic mains-powered systems to solar and battery-powered units. These can be used to trigger the ToggleBlok Valve to open or close based on high water levels.
For sites using ToggleBlok to manage flow control, adding a flood alarm provides early warning of backed-up drainage or impending overflow, allowing for timely intervention and increased system visibility.
Remote activated call point

The RACP is a wireless remote control unit designed to work with any monitoring device equipped with a volt-free, normally open contact. It uses SMS over a mobile network to activate up to eight ToggleBlok Valves. This is ideal for remote or hard-to-cable locations.
Simply insert a SIM card and ensure a reliable mobile signal. RACP units can turn any monitoring device into a smart trigger, linking alarms and sensors directly to your pollution containment system.
